ABAP code to call this SAP report using the submit statement

This report can be called from another progam/report simply by using the ABAP SUBMIT statement, see below for example ABAP code snipts of how to do this.






SUBMIT RMPS_EXPORT_ALL. "Basic submit
SUBMIT RMPS_EXPORT_ALL AND RETURN. "Return to original report after report execution complete
SUBMIT RMPS_EXPORT_ALL VIA SELECTION-SCREEN. "Display selection screen of submitted report to user
